摘要
研究了铌、氮、铈对耐热钢的力学性能、热疲劳性能和抗氧化性能的影响 ,并对裂纹的扩展进行了系统分析。结果表明 :含有少量铌、氮、铈的ZG2Cr2 5Ni2 0耐热钢在 2 0℃ 90 0℃循环条件下 ,裂纹扩展速率明显降低。
The effect of niobium, nitrogen and cerium element s on the tensile, heat fatigue and oxidation resistance properties of heat resistance steels were studied and the crack growth in steel were analyzed syste matically. The results showed that as a small amount of Nb, N and Ce elements ex isted in heat resistance steel ZG2Cr25Ni20, the crack growth rate in 20 ℃ 900 ℃ heat cycle decreased obviously.
